It just depends on the people playing the class. Once you get it down, vanguards can be great assets to the team, you just have to find one that isn't retarded about the way they do things.

I personally used the drell vanguard (until the item delete bug locked him :() , the grenades they have access to are great for helping clear out a room without rushing in and getting shot in the face. 

being able to charge in, drop a cluster of grenades and back flip out again is very handy when you have a teammate that is down just inside an area full of enemies, there is an objective that is swarmed, or your team just needs an extra punch to clear out a wave.   Fully charged cluster grenades can drop any non "heavy" opponents and dont have the stupid shield draining issues that nova brings with it. 

Bottom Line, don't hate but... educate?

Sucks you've played with ****ty Vanguards then. They are high risk high reward, and with the mechanics of the class its easy to faceplant yourself if you're too greedy. As far as clicking nodes, hacking, and getting in on extractions...that's more of a newbie mistake than a Vanguard mistake. Many people don't know (or maybe don't notice) you get a time bonus on objectives and such. I've played plenty of public matches recently (damn PSN and the 1.02 vs 1.01 patch) where I just spoke up when they weren't helping hack or w/e and normally they got on line. Kinda sucks for other classes with how Charge works, but what can you do? Try to remember the good ones and the bad ones...
